Sony Shutting Down Servers for Multiple PS3 Games

All good things must come to an end, because it’s expensive to keep things running and that eventually outpaces the money coming in. Thus, it will soon be time to say goodbye to a few PS3 games. Well, to be specific, to their online modes.

This time, three games are being closed down, as far as their online functions are concerned. These games are Twisted Metal , Warhawk , and PlayStation All-Stars . Each of these games are losing their server support on October 25, 2018.

In this case, the biggest causality is Warhawk , which is for the most part an online-only game. However, if you’re one of the remaining Warhawk fans and have friends you can play with locally, it’s still possible to put the PS3 on LAN mode and play that way. Otherwise, PlayStation All-Stars and Twisted Metal both have modes allowing offline play.

This also applies to PlayStation All-Stars on the Vita. No more online for handheld gamers either!
